Menú

| UNINET | Lista de correo: eusalud-l | Suscripciones | Club AUTOPSIAS | REA::EJAUTOPSY
Casos PAT::UNINET | BIOMED::UNINET | MisApuntes | ASION

Optimiza Linux

Una forma recomendable de progresar en la curva de aprendizaje de Linux es suscribirse a alguna de las muchas revistas especializadas que existen. Yo aconsejo Todo Linux de Iberprensa. Esta revista incluye muchos reportajes, talleres prácticos, cursos, análisis de software, además de entregar con cada número un DVD con las actualizaciones más recientes de las distros más conocidas. Uno de los cursos prácticos que he leído últimamente llevaba el titulo de Optimiza Linux.

Optimiza Linux: Una vez que tenemos instalado y funcionando nuestro sistema GNU/Linux es hora de plantearse qué podemos hacer para mejorar el rendimiento y la eficiencia del mismo. En general, se trata de obtener un sistema que se ajuste perfectamente a una serie de requisitos, logrando que funcione de la forma más eficiente posible. Todo Linux ha elaborado un reportaje en su número 104 donde muestra una serie de técnicas y procesos que pueden ayudarnos a correr de forma robusta y eficiente nuestro Linux. Aborda como optimizar el sistema, particularmente compilando el kernel de forma lo personalizada posible. Podemos ejecutar el comando dmesg para ver toda la información del sistema obtenida por el kernel durante el arranque, y en base a esta información ajustarlo a nuestras necesidades. Es habitual que en nuestro sistema estén corriendo también una serie de servicios (procesos en segundo plano que se lanzan cuando arrancamos el sistema). Es posible que algunos de estos servicios esté de más y que no los necesitemos. Para ver los servicios que están corriendo en nuestro máquina podemos utilizar el comando chkconfig. Otro aspecto de la optimización es el empleo de herramientas de monitotización. Entre estas contamos con ps y top. Utilizando los argumentos aux junto al comando ps [ps ax] podemos ver información sobre los procesos que se estén ejecutando. Por otro lado top nos indica la actividad del sistema, refrescando la información cada segundo. Para monitorizar con un solo comando la memoria, CPU y el estado del sistema de entrada y salida (I/O) consumido por cada proceso, disponemos del comando vmstat, que nos informa sobre estos datos de forma resumida. free es otro comando que nos informa sobre la memoria total, la swap y los buffer de caché. Si a free le pasamos el argumento -m la información que nos devuelve será en MB, y si le pasamos el argumento -g nos la devolverá en GB. Otros comandos útiles serían: iostat, pmap -d, iptraf, netstat, y tcdump. Lee sus man para ampliar información sobre los mismos.

____
Eusalud